FinnHun Finnish-Hungarian-English on-line dictionary and thesaurus

Dictionary

gizzard []

Words

Hungarian (1)

Finnish (2)

More results

gizzard

Wiktionary (1)

n A portion of the esophagus of either a bird or an annelid that contains ingested grit and is used to grind up ingested food before it is transferred to the stomach.